Solar Container: Multifunction Solar Panel Technology

Panasonic developed a multifunctional solar panel technology as a provider of electrical energy for people in rural areas. 

The company introduced its new solar panel technology called containers solar panels, solar module and 48 completed the battery, Panasonic Gobel Indonesia office in Jakarta on Wednesday.

According to Panasonic Gobel Indonesia president director Ichiro Suganuma, these solar panels to generate electricity independently to power an average of six kWh per day throughout the year as needed.

"This could still be used though not every day there is sun. There is energy storage battery that can last for two to three days," he said.
Electrical energy from solar panels, according to him, then can be used to animate a variety of electronic devices such as lights, televisions, refrigerators and more.
"It would be better if we are using energy-efficient electronic devices," he said.
In addition to domestic use, he explains, container panels can also be used as a provider of electric energy at retail stores and health facilities, education, and communication.
Ichiro also explained that it had not market these products in Indonesia.
"Want to test first. The target could be marketed because of the potential market is large enough, the rural population who do not have access to electricity is still a lot," he said.
In the early stages, he said, the test device of solar panels will be conducted in areas that the power supply disrupted by the disaster.
"We want to make plans with the Indonesian Red Cross (PMI), would be sent to anywhere will suit your needs. This will be part of the implementation of our corporate social responsibility," he said.
